The objective of my thesis was to design a collection of six garments and produce one made from fabric I developed using Silk Cloqué which involves felting wool in between two layers of silk gauze. The process was initially developed by David and Dorita Reyen of Reyen Design Studio based on the work of textile designer Polly Stirling. I became interested in Silk Cloqué when the Reyens were selling their work in Slocum Hall. In fall 2004, I began working with them. A line of original bridesmaids’ dresses began as a market research project for Lara Hélène Bridal Atelier inNew York City. I was to research information on current clientele and find out what they were looking for in a bridesmaid’s dress. In doing my research I sourced books on brides and weddings, internet wedding sites, conducted surveys, and took personal interviews with the founders of Lara Hélène. The market research turned into a concept to design an original line of bridesmaids’ dresses that filled a void for a unique and elegant collection that fit into Lara Hélène’s company image.
